Louis-Philippe Provencher is an associate in Gowling WLG's Montréal office, practising in the area of commercial and civil litigation.
Prior to attending law school, Louis-Philippe completed a bachelor of music at the Université de Montréal and worked in the Montréal art scene as a freelance drummer. He also taught drums and percussions for several years.
During his legal studies, Louis-Philippe was actively involved with Pro Bono Students Canada, where he published several articles pertaining to current judicial events. He was also an executive member of the Law Faculty of the Université de Montréal's Arts Committee, which promotes intellectual property law within the student community.
